How would you compare them to the HE6seā€™s?

I am guessing much easier to drive?

so the XS has a more incisive punch, way more soundstage (width, depth, and height), they take about 1/3 of the power, and are way more forgiving on sources. overall a lot more fun natural tuning. vocals seem a tad more intimate, a little fuller, and almost makes me notice that hifiman dip in the he6 more. timbre is about even, very natural. he6 has better sub bass rumble, detail (but not by much), macrodynamics (but the he6 just outstanding for that). XS has very very good imaging and with the soundstage size it makes it have a bit more noticeable separation in distant instruments than the he6. rear imaging on the XS is phenomenal and kind of reminds me of more of an audeze soundstage than a hifiman, honestly, but bigger.

hmmā€¦just tried a couple rumbly songs and the XS does have pretty decent rumble to it as well. idk man, these things are just surprising me more and more.

Nice to meet you all, Iā€™ve had my set for abt 2 weeks now and Iā€™m slightly tempted to return them. I CANNOT STAND THE COMFORT of these things, the clamp force is wayy too low which ends up giving me a hotspot on my head after 1-2 hours of listening, it doesnā€™t help that the pads are stiff as shit.
Iā€™ve also noticed some minor build issues with my pair, the left ear cup requires more force to tilt the cups which is not the case with my 400is. Both cups also had a dent (see pic) .
I canā€™t comment on the sound as I do not have a good reference point of ā€œgoodā€ sound and do not want to provide bad/inaccurate information. What I can say is that I do like the sound but I canā€™t stand the comfort.
